Job description
A Student Advisor is a key role in the institution that will be responsible for brand awareness, marketing, lead generation and sales, with specific reference to converted registrations in both the build up to and during peak registration season. A prospective candidate needs to be able to demonstrate experience, strong relationships, and success in this role.
Roles and Responsibilities:
· Hold strong relationships with regional schools and key stakeholders Life Orientation teacher, principals, and district managers.
· Ability to continue to build new relationships where a relationship doesn’t exist.
· Setting appointments with the schools to ensure you meet face to face with grade 10’s, 11’s and 12’s.
· Able to effectively deliver a captivating presentation at schools that will drive strong interest in the institution.
· Attend career expos.
· Planning and organizing open day at campus.
· Planning and attending mall activations.
· Generate sales through telephonic consultation and face-to face consultation.
· Conduct interviews with potential students.
· Record prospective student details from each enquiry on CRM.
· Continually update CRM based on lead interest and commitment.
· Manage communication to leads which will include:
· Sending out SMS’s to lead databases
· Email information to lead databases
· Conduct follow-up interviews with students
· Carry out accurate and efficient sales related administration.
· Capture application and enrolment information on ERP system.
· Able to send daily, weekly & monthly reports to management showing productivity upcoming tasks and activities.
· Achieve and exceed Sales targets
· Schools marketing and database collect targets
Pay: From R7 000,00 per month
